Features, inter alia, The Walker family (Grand Jorasses and Matterhorn), Frederick Gardner (Elbrus), Colin Kirkus and Menlove Edwards (nuff said really!), Alan Rouse and a certain Mr Harold William Tilman who lived in Wallasey for most of his remarkable and adventurous life.
Perhaps the words of one of these Merseyside Pioneers sum up what it is all about……
"I grew up exuberant in body but with a nervy, craving mind. It was wanting something more, something tangible. It sought for reality intensely, always as if it were not there... But you see at once what I do…. I climb." - John Menlove Edwards 1910-1958
